I have the same problem in current alpha release of Ubuntu Raring 13.04, where util-linux is still at version 2.20.1-5.1ubuntu2.
when I try to connect an external hard disk eSATA with ext4 partition, it is recognized but can not be mounted and content is not accessible, I get the following error message :
Error mounting /dev/sdd1 at /media/valeryan24/Verbatim: Command-line `mount -t "ext4" -o "uhelper=udisks2,nodev,nosuid" "/dev/sdd1" "/media/valeryan24/Verbatim"' exited with non-zero exit status 32: mount: wrong fs type, bad option, bad superblock on /dev/sdd1,
missing codepage or helper program, or other error
In some cases useful info is found in syslog - try
dmesg | tail or so
With USB key or external disk it works, not with this eSTATA one.
